    It had been a while since my last trip to New Orleans, so I spent Super Bowl weekend back in town enjoying some gambling and early Mardi Gras celebrations. My original plan was dinner at La Boca Steakhouse, one of my longtime go-to spots, but a same-day call about kitchen equipment issues forced them to cancel reservations for the evening. With plans suddenly open, we pivoted and decided to try Restaurant Rebirth -- a fitting name considering the change of plans and my familiarity with the space from its previous restaurant days. The menu is fairly focused, leaning toward farm-to-table Cajun-Creole dishes. Dinner started with cornbread served with honey, and honestly, it was incredible. I could have happily made a meal out of that alone (regret not asking for seconds). I began with a blueberry martini that was a little too sweet for my taste, then switched to an Abita Amber, which paired much better with the food. For appetizers we ordered the BBQ pork belly, shrimp and eggplant, and the oyster angel hair pasta -- all very good, with the pork belly being the standout. Entrées included a beautifully presented whole blackened redfish that tasted as good as it looked, a 20-oz boneless ribeye cooked to a perfect medium rare with crawfish tasso maque choux, and a double-cut pork chop. The steak had great flavor but was surprisingly a bit tough, the only real disappointment of the night. The pork chop, however, completely stole the show -- perfectly cooked, tender, and one of the best I've had. [[HIGHLIGHT]]Service was attentive without being overbearing, and the space remains dark, warm, and inviting -- a vibe I've always liked in this location.[[ENDHIGHLIGHT]] Overall: a very enjoyable meal and a great backup plan when our original reservation fell through. I'll definitely return, especially if La Boca isn't available on my next trip to New Orleans.

    I have a new favorite restaurant. This place is phenomenal. We went last night to celebrate my husband's birthday and it was not disappointing. We started with the fried oysters appetizer and the pork belly appetizer and both were amazing. The pork belly appetizer could have been a little spicier, but it was delicious. We then shared a serving of the gumbo. We split a 22 oz. ribeye for the entree. It was one of the most delicious steaks i have eaten in my life. We will definitely go back and recommend this to our friends.

    My husband said it was the best Pork Belly he ever had. We went for my husband's birthday and our anniversary. We unfortunately wasn't that hungry and it was later than we normally have dinner but since it was a special occasion we wanted to try an upscale restaurant that wasn't in the French Quarter. We opted for only appetizers. We had a very small cast iron little bowl of gumbo, it was full of flavor and very good! I would definitely have a full bowl to myself if we should ever go to NOLA again. We had the pork belly and my husband loved it he said it was the BEST. We had the greens that were good but a little too sweet for my taste. They gave my husband bread pudding for his birthday but he isn't a fan of bread pudding so he didn't like it but I did. The service was slower than I thought it should be for deserts, but our waiter was very attentive so we didn't mind it much. Unfortunately I am bad with names, but one of the owners also was very attentive. I definitely recommend the restaurant if you want good food, an upscale experience away from the French Quarter. [[HIGHLIGHT]]The Ambiance was romantic it's a small restaurant.[[ENDHIGHLIGHT]] It was very nice that when we walked in they said our names like they were waiting for us. I enjoyed the conversation with one of the owners finding out he previously worked with Emeril Lagasse who I have been a fan of for years.
